Caused by: oracle.as.jmx.framework.exceptions.ManagementException: JPS-01033: Cannot set credential.
Getting this error while configuring users in weblogic 12.1.2
[java] SEVERE: Failed to create user osmfallout in credential store.
[java] oracle.as.jmx.framework.exceptions.ManagementException: JPS-01033: Cannot set credential. Reason oracle.security.jps.JpsException: oracle.security.jps.service.policystore.PolicyObjectNotFoundException: parent DN does not exist [cn=CredentialStore,cn=opssSecurityStore,cn=JPSContext,cn=opssRoot], uniqueID: [cn=osm,cn=CredentialStore,cn=opssSecurityStore,cn=JPSContext,cn=opssRoot], Attributes: {objectclass=objectclass: top, orclContainer, cn=cn: osm}, JpsDataManager: oracle.security.jps.internal.policystore.rdbms.JpsDBDataManager@39b87ba9.
[java] at oracle.security.jps.mas.mgmt.jmx.credstore.JpsCredentialBeanImpl.rethrowAsManagementException(JpsCredentialBeanImpl.java:245)
[java] at oracle.security.jps.mas.mgmt.jmx.credstore.JpsCredentialBeanImpl.setCredential(JpsCredentialBeanImpl.java:503)